Bank of Stockton reduced its holdings in shares of Bank of America Corporation (NYSE:BAC) by 2.9% during the 1st qu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the SEC. The institutional investor owned 16,730 shares of the financial services provider’s stock after selling 500 shares during the period. Bank of Stockton’s holdings in Bank of America were worth $698,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Bank of America Company Profile
Bank of America Corporation, through its subsidiaries, provides banking and financial products and services for individual consumers, small and middle-market businesses, institutional investors, large corporations, and governments worldwide. It operates in four segments: Consumer Banking, Global Wealth & Investment Management (GWIM), Global Banking, and Global Markets.
